About (Z)-docos-13-enoyl chloride
(Z)-docos-13-enoyl chloride (PubChem CID 5364502) has the molecular formula C22H41ClO
and a molecular weight of 357.02 g/mol. Its IUPAC name is (Z)-docos-13-enoyl chloride.
